Madonna to Direct Upcoming Michaela DePrince-Based MGM Flick TAKING FLIGHT

According to Variety, Pop Icon Madonna is set to direct upcoming MGM Drama TAKING FLIGHT Based on the life of ballerina MICHAELA DePrince.

MGM has been developing "Taking Flight" since 2015, when it first bought rights to MICHAELA and Elaine DePrince's memoir, "Taking Flight: From War Orphan to Star Ballerina." The book follows MICHAELA DePrince's life from an orphan in war-torn Sierra Leone to a world-renowned ballerina.

"Michaela's journey resonated with me deeply as both an artist and an activist who understands adversity," Madonna stated. "We have a unique opportunity to shed light on Sierra Leone and let MICHAELA be THE VOICE for all the orphaned children she grew up beside. I am honored to bring her story to life."

Madonna will direct from a screenplay by Camilla Blackett ("New Girl"). Alloy Entertainment's Leslie Morgenstein and Elysa Koplovitz Dutton will produce alongside Ben Pugh and Guy Oseary. MGM Production president Jonathan Glickman and Tabitha Shick are overseeing the project on behalf of the studio.

Madonna made her directing debut on the 2008 British comedy "Filth and Wisdom." She also helmed and co-wrote 2011's "W.E.," which chronicled the relationship between King Edward VIII and American divorcee Wallis Simpson. Her upcoming projects include co-writing and directing a film adaptation of Andrew Sean Greer's novel "The Impossible Lives of Greta Wells." The pop icon has sold more than 300 million records worldwide, Madonna is recognized as the best-selling female recording artist of all time by Guinness World Records. The Recording Industry Association of America (RIAA) listed her as the second highest-certified female artist in the U.S., with 64.5 million album units. According to Billboard, Madonna is the most successful solo act on its Hot 100 singles chart and second overall behind the Beatles. She is also the highest-grossing solo touring artist of all time, earning U.S. $1.4 billion from her concert tickets. In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in her first year of eligibility, Madonna topped VH1's countdown of 100 Greatest Women in Music. Additionally, Rolling Stone listed her among THE 100 Greatest Artists of All Time and THE 100 Greatest Songwriters of All Time.
